Output ceafa51f8197e39b0c12a4b22e4b4e356c5de78a8a3959bbabd4939e6a1e1981:2

value
5169580250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4957e85d3428c592ca6d5e4fdd77800b1acf180a OP_EQUAL
address
38NpZUmM5cNZUdD3dcG9ZCpftY9Cc2j6SY
transaction
ceafa51f8197e39b0c12a4b22e4b4e356c5de78a8a3959bbabd4939e6a1e1981
spent
true